The bottom line

SW4 9SW offers exceptional schools (100% Good/Outstanding), low crime and fast broadband — strong value for Families who can accept its trade-offs.

The catch: high noise levels nearby.

Insufficient sales data

Only 2 sales recorded in the last 24 months — too few for a reliable median price. Price figures have been withheld to avoid misleading comparisons.

SW4 district median

£593,750

Based on 238 sales from postcodes with sufficient data
